    Anthony Ulysses Thompson, Jr. (September 2, 1975 – June 1, 2007) [1] was an American singer–songwriter. Thompson was best known as the lead vocalist of the American R&B quintet Hi-Five, which had hit singles such as "I Like the Way (The Kissing Game)" and "I Can't Wait Another Minute".

    Hi-5 was a Greek pop girl group formed in Athens in 2003 through the Greek version of the reality TV show Popstars. The group consisted of Marlain Angelides , Frosso Papacharalambous , Nancy Stergiopoulou , Irini Psixrami and Shaya . [ 1 ]
